2021.11.28 22:09 ALiddleBiddle The judge, the lawyers and Ghislaine Maxwell: a scorecard for watching the trial in New York
By Julie K. Brown + Ben Weider November 28, 2021
Link to article The Judge Alison Nathan
United States District Judge Alison Nathan was appointed to the federal bench by former president Barack Obama in 2011. Prior to serving as a federal judge, she clerked for the late Supreme Court Justice John Paul Stevens, worked as counsel for the attorney general of New York and was an associate White House counsel and special assistant for Obama.
Nathan has presided over a number of high-profile copyright cases, including one in 2013 in which she ruled that two news organizations violated the copyright of a photographer by using for commercial purposes photos that had been posted on Twitter.
In February, Nathan took the rare step of asking the Department of Justice to open an investigation into possible misconduct by New York federal prosecutors who withheld evidence in a case involving an Iranian businessman charged with breaking U.S. sanctions by funneling millions of dollars to his family business in Iran. She also issued a blistering criticism of the office that handled the case.
Since being assigned to the Maxwell case, Nathan has made clear that she intends to keep the trial on track. She has issued a number of pre-trial rulings, including permitting prosecutors to use the word “victim” when discussing Maxwell’s accusers and allowing those accusers to testify anonymously using pseudonyms. She has also denied Maxwell bail on four occasions.
Nathan has carefully scrutinized document redactions proposed by both Maxwell and the prosecutors. She granted Maxwell’s request to keep secret undisclosed “sensational” information contained in the court documents and transcripts, noting that removal of the material was necessary to protect the integrity of the investigation and the privacy of third parties who are not part of the criminal case. However, she has limited some of the redactions proposed by prosecutors.
In another twist, Nathan last week was nominated to the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it, one step away from the Supreme Court.
She said she intends to see the Maxwell case through to the end.
For the Prosecution
Alison G. Moe
Assistant U.S. Attorney Alison G. Moe is a member of the Southern District of New York’s Public Corruption Unit. Prior to the Maxwell case, she was one of the federal prosecutors pursuing fraud charges against Steve Bannon, Donald Trump’s top campaign adviser in 2016. Trump pardoned Bannon in January as the former adviser was awaiting trial on charges he duped individuals donating to build a privately sponsored section of the southern border wall.
Moe also took on a federal criminal case involving scam political action committees, and as a former member of Southern District of New York’s narcotics unit she prosecuted a number of drug-trafficking cases.
Moe is a graduate of Dartmouth College and Columbia Law School. Before joining the U.S. Attorney’s Office, she worked as an assistant corporate counsel in the New York City Law Department.
Maurene R. Comey
Assistant U.S. Attorney Maurene R. Comey has been with SDNY since 2014. She is a chief of the Violent and Organized Crime Unit. Comey is one of the assistant U.S. attorneys who charged a prominent New York gynecologist last year with sexually assaulting six women, including the wife of former Democratic presidential candidate Andrew Yang.
Comey was also involved in a 2019 sex trafficking case in which 11 men were indicted on allegations that they forced 10 victims, some of whom were minors, to be sexually assaulted and abused as part of a commercial sex operation.
A graduate of William & Mary and Harvard Law School, she is the daughter of former FBI Director James Comey, who once served as the U.S. attorney for the Southern District of New York.
Andrew Rohrbach
Assistant U.S. Attorney Andrew Rohrbach has been with SDNY since 2019. He previously served as an attorney for the Department of Justice. In 2013, while at Harvard Law School, Rohrbach was designated as the “best oralist” in the Ames Moot Court Competition. Among the judges of the competition were the late Supreme Court Justice Ruth Bader Ginsberg and Judge Merrick Garland, now the attorney general. He is also a graduate of Yale, where he served on the debate team.
Lara E. Pomerantz
Assistant U.S. Attorney Lara E. Pomerantz was hired by SDNY in 2015. Prior to becoming a federal prosecutor, Pomerantz was an associate with the New York law firm Simpson, Thacher & Bartlett.
She is a member of SDNY’s Public Corruption Unit. Most recently, she handled the prosecution of a Drug Enforcement Administration agent alleged to have helped a drug-trafficking gang smuggle cocaine from Puerto Rico to the mainland as part of a decades-long drug operation. The gang committed at least seven murders.
In 2018, Pomerantz successfully prosecuted the corruption case of Norman Seabrook, the flamboyant former boss of the association representing New York City corrections officers.
She is a graduate of Duke University and the University of Pennsylvania Law School.
For the Defense
Bobbie Sternheim
Ghislaine Maxwell’s trial is undoubtedly defense attorney Bobbi Sternheim’s most prominent case, but she is no stranger to defending the accused accomplices of notorious men. She represented a Saudi man accused of being one of Osama bin Laden’s top deputies, as well as a Vietnamese man accused of a thwarted suicide bombing plot at London’s Heathrow airport at the direction of another Al Qaeda leader, the American Anwar al-Awlaki.
Both men were ultimately convicted and the 2016 trial of the Vietnamese man, Minh Quang Pham, was overseen by Nathan, who was recently recommended by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er for an appointment to the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it.
Sternheim has a long history in New York as a defense attorney and has defended alleged members of organized crime, drug dealers and public officials accused of corruption.
Sternheim has repeatedly raised concerns about Maxwell’s treatment in federal custody at Brooklyn’s Metropolitan Detention Center. She previously brought a medical malpractice suit against the facility on behalf of Sean Erez, a convicted drug kingpin who had attracted notoriety for using young Hasidic Jewish men as his drug mules. The case was settled.
Sternheim, a graduate of the State University of New York at Buffalo, John Jay College of Criminal Justice and the Benjamin N. Cardozo School of Law at Yeshiva Univesity, has served as the president of the New York Women’s Bar Association from 1992 to 1993 and is currently the Criminal Justice Act representative for the Southern District of New York, representing private attorneys appointed by federal courts to provide legal services to defendants who can’t afford to pay. She has taught law courses at Pace University and Yeshiva University’s Cardozo School of Law, her alma mater, where she has led the Intensive Trial Advocacy Program.
The Maxwell trial might introduce her to many, but she’s had at least one moment in the spotlight before: In 1993, she was cast to stand in for soap opera star Linda Dano on “Another World.” Asked about the experience on CNN, Sternheim said her years as an attorney came in handy.
“When one is in court as a litigator, one can be theatrical in front of a jury,” she said. “And I suppose there are some similarities.”
Laura Menninger
Laura Menninger has been an attorney in Colorado for the past 20 years, though earlier in her career she clerked for a judge in the Southern District of New York, U.S. District Judge Lewis A. Kaplan, who officiated at her 1999 wedding.
Kaplan is currently presiding over the lawsuit brought against Prince Andrew by Virginia Giuffre, who has said Maxwell recruited her for Jeffrey Epstein’s abuse and that Maxwell and Epstein trafficked her to various high-profile friends. Menninger also represented Maxwell in a defamation lawsuit Giuffre brought against her in 2015, which was settled in 2017.
Menninger, who was a public defender in Colorado before joining the firm of Haddon, Morgan and Foreman, has represented an acupuncturist accused of sexually assaulting clients, a cannabis dispensary accused of allowing customers to exceed daily limits on purchases, and a drug dealer whose 10-year-old daughter was killed in a shootout during a drug deal gone bad at his Denver apartment.
Menninger helped then-Colorado Avalanche goalie Semyon Varlamov prevail in a lawsuit brought against him by a former girlfriend seeking damages for assault and battery.
Menninger convinced a judge to block evidence of graphic pictures and descriptions of beatings Varlamov allegedly had given his former girlfriend. Varlamov is now a goalie for the New York Islanders.
Menninger is a graduate of Duke University and Stanford Law School.
Jeffrey Pagliuca
Jeffrey Pagliuca is an attorney at the same Denver law firm as Menninger and also worked as a public defender in Colorado before joining the firm. Pagliuca’s notable cases include a Colorado Springs real estate developer, Ray Marshall, accused of embezzling $1 million from a city incentive package designed to keep the U.S. Olympic Committee headquarters in Colorado Springs. The charges against Marshall were dropped eight years later.
Pagliuca also represented Craig Lewis, an editor for the Globe tabloid, who was charged with bribery and extortion for allegedly trying to buy a copy of the ransom note for JonBenet Ramsey, the 6-year-old child beauty queen found dead in her Boulder, Colorado, home whose death attracted worldwide attention. Charges against Lewis were dismissed after he agreed to donate $100,000 to a journalism ethics program at the University of Colorado. Pagliuca also represented Maxwell in the lawsuit brought against her by Virginia Giuffre. Pagliuca is a graduate of Duke University and the University of Denver College of Law, where he has also taught.
Christian Everdell
Christian Everdell worked as a federal prosecutor in the Southern District of New York for nearly a decade, spending time as part of of the district’s terrorism and international narcotics unit and its complex frauds and cybercrime unit.
He brought cases against members of Al Qaeda, FARC and other terrorist groups as well as Russian arms dealer Viktor Bout and the founders of a digital currency called Liberty Reserve that was used to launder nearly $8 billion. While at SDNY, he was part of a team that brought charges against Joaquin “El Chapo” Guzman, for which the team was awarded a True Heroes Award from the Federal Drug Agents Foundation, according to Everdell’s company biography. Everdell graduated from Princeton University and Harvard Law School.

2021.11.17 02:39 ALiddleBiddle New Wrinkle in Ghislaine Maxwell Trial as Judge May Be Promoted
November 16, 2021
Link to article The Manhattan judge presiding in the high-profile trial of Ghislaine Maxwell, the longtime associate of Jeffrey Epstein, will be recommended to the White House on Tuesday evening for a prestigious federal appeals court post by Senator Chuck Schumer of New York, his office said.
The judge, Alison J. Nathan, 49, has spent a decade on the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York. On Tuesday, she was overseeing jury selection in the trial of Ms. Maxwell, who has been charged with sex trafficking and with helping Mr. Epstein recruit, groom and ultimately sexually abuse girls. Ms. Maxwell has pleaded not guilty.
The trial, in which opening arguments are scheduled for Nov. 29, could last six weeks, defense lawyers and prosecutors have said in court filings.
If Judge Nathan is nominated by President Biden and confirmed by the Senate during the trial, she could still continue to preside in the case, two legal ethics experts said. Judges are frequently elevated to appeals courts from lower courts where they are actively involved in trials and other cases.
Still, the Maxwell trial, with its connection to Mr. Epstein and the worldwide attention it has attracted, is anything but a routine matter.
Asked whether Judge Nathan would stay on the case if nominated for the appellate judgeship, Edward Friedland, a spokesman for the District Court, said in a statement that he could “neither confirm nor deny that she is under consideration.”
“But I have every reason to believe that if she is recommended or nominated she would — as is customary for lower court judges who are nominated to higher courts — continue to do her day job and preside over the trial to its conclusion,” Mr. Friedland said.
Mr. Schumer, the Democratic majority leader and the party’s senior lawmaker in New York State, is recommending Judge Nathan for a seat on the influential U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it, which is one level below the Supreme Court.
The recommendation means Judge Nathan is almost certain to be nominated by the White House, as presidents, in choosing judges and U.S. attorneys, traditionally defer to their party’s senior lawmaker in each state.
Mr. Schumer, in a statement on Tuesday, said Judge Nathan’s “experience, legal brilliance, love of the rule of law and perspective would be invaluable in ensuring the federal judiciary fulfills its obligation to ensure equal justice for all.”
Mr. Schumer’s office also noted that Judge Nathan would be the second openly gay woman to serve on the Second Circuit.
Judge Nathan was appointed to the District Court by President Barack Obama in 2011. She earlier served as a special counsel to the solicitor general of New York State, in the state attorney general’s office. Before that, she was an associate White House counsel and special assistant to Mr. Obama.
Judge Nathan is a graduate of Cornell Law School and served as a law clerk to Justice John Paul Stevens in the Supreme Court’s 2001-2 term.
It is not unprecedented for a federal appellate judge, even after confirmation, to continue to hear cases in the trial court, the legal experts said.
At least two former judges on the District Court in Manhattan — Denny Chin and Richard J. Sullivan — continued to handle cases in the lower court after they were appointed to the Second Circuit.
Rebecca Roiphe, a professor at New York Law School, said the only theoretical issue she could foresee would be if Judge Nathan were confirmed quickly and her new duties pulled her away “from a very time-consuming trial.”
“But I think that’s unlikely given the timeline here,” Professor Roiphe said.
Stephen Gillers, a professor at New York University School of Law, said one hypothetical question was whether Ms. Maxwell’s lawyers might seek to have the judge recuse herself because the Biden administration would be in a position to derail her promotion if she did not favor the government in the trial.
But he said in his view, based on hundreds of cases involving judicial recusal, a promotion like Judge Nathan’s would not provide a basis for such a request.
“This does not even come close to the sort of interest that leads to recusal,” he said.
Judge Nathan is known for her independence, and in at least two cases she issued blistering criticism of the U.S. Attorney’s Office in Manhattan after it was accused of failing to turn over potentially favorable evidence to the defense before trial.

2021.02.02 21:36 Markdd8 Women's group warns of major sex trafficking if casino plan goes through
Hawaii casino could increase sex trafficking, report warns. Excerpt:
A state agency that works toward equality for women and girls issued a blistering report Monday outlining the ills associated with casinos, particularly as they relate to the sex trade...“Casinos bring more than just revenue. They bring a bachelor party culture,” said Khara Jabola-Carolus, executive director of the Hawaii State Commission on the Status of Women...
= = =
Some of the social science assertions coming from Khara Jabola-Carolus’s report:
Gambling With Women’s Safety: – A Feminist Assessment of Proposed Resort-Casino:
Nationally, a person being sex trafficked in a hotel/resort setting is forced, coerced, or intimidated to perform sex acts on an average of 5 to 10 customers per day. (p. 2)
Sex trafficking is distinct from prostitution: sex trafficking is the means, prostitution, pornography and stripping are the ends. Both are relatively new problems in Hawaiʻi that became systematic after Western contact. (p. 2)
According to law enforcement (Spotlight) data compiled by The Avery Center, there (is an estimate of) a total 18,375 sex trafficking victims in Honolulu...(that's a total of)...23,887,812 commercial sex acts per year performed by sex trafficking victims in Honolulu. (p. 3)
= = =
Viewpoints on sex trafficking from other sources:
Reason, May 2019
The Sex Trafficking Panic: When police charged New England Patriots owner Robert Kraft with soliciting prostitution, the press said the police rescued sex slaves. "They were women who were from China, who were forced into sex slavery," said Trevor Noah on The Daily Show. We're told this happens all the time.
It's bunk, says Reason Associate Editor Elizabeth Nolan Brown. In the Robert Kraft case, she points out, "They had all these big announcements at first saying they had busted up an international sex trafficking ring, implying these women weren't allowed to leave.” But now prosecutors acknowledge that there was no trafficking. The women were willing sex workers...
Politicians tell us that thousands of children are forced into the sex trade. "Three-hundred thousand American children are at risk!" said Rep. Ann Wagner on the floor of Congress…
...celebrities...perpetuate the myth that sex slavery is rampant. "You can go online and buy a child for sex. It's as easy as ordering a pizza," says Amy Schumer. "Thousands of children are raped every day!" says comedian Seth Meyers...
The Guardian, a decade ago:
Prostitution and trafficking – the anatomy of a moral panic There is something familiar about the tide of misinformation which has swept through the subject of sex trafficking in the UK: it flows through exactly the same channels as the now notorious torrent about Saddam Hussein's weapons. In the story of UK sex trafficking, the conclusions of academics who study the sex trade have been subjected to the same treatment as the restrained reports of intelligence analysts who studied Iraqi weapons – stripped of caution, stretched to their most alarming possible meaning and tossed into the public domain. There, they have been picked up by the media who have stretched them even further in stories which have then been treated as reliable sources by politicians, who in turn provided quotes for more misleading stories...
("...the conclusions of academics who study the sex trade..." More than a few academics will regularly come up with the exact conclusions they want to find.)
The New Republic, Oct. 2015:
"Human Trafficking" Has Become a Meaningless Term – Politicians and activists often abuse it to push for punitive laws or to incite moral panic. President Barack Obama has famously declared that "human trafficking" is "modern-day slavery." He's also said that it "is a crime that can take many forms." The second definition is a good deal more accurate. "Trafficking," in practice, is less a clear-cut crime than a call to moral panic. The vagueness of the definition allows or even encourages governments, organizations, and researchers to claim that there are tens of millions of trafficking victims worldwide on the basis of little more than hyperbolic guesses...
According to Alison Bass, author of Getting Screwed: Sex Workers and the Law, "trafficking has become a new name for an old problem, which is largely teenage runaways." Young people who run away from abusive situations at home, and who sell sex to survive, are considered trafficking victims by default under many federal and state laws. This, despite the fact that hardly any teen runaways have pimps or traffickers, according to a John Jay College of Criminal Justice study. Most see sex work as the best way to support themselves on the street, given the limited legal and social service options available for children who run away from home. And most, Bass told me, do not travel out of their own town or city, much less out of the country...
